Vespasian. AD 69-79. Æ Sestertius (35mm, 24.38 g, 6h). "Judaea Capta" commemorative. Rome mint. Struck AD 71. Laureate head right / IVDΛEΛ CAPTA, palm tree; to left, bound captive Jew standing right; to right, Judaea seated right on cuirass in attitude of mourning; both figures surrounded by arms; S C in exergue. RIC II.1 159; Hendin 1500. Dark green patina with touches of red, a bit of roughness. VF.

From the Lampasas Collection. Ex George Bernert Collection (Classical Numismatic Group Electronic Auction 406, 27 September 2017), lot 699.
